To encourage USD law students to engage in international study, USD School of Law offers scholarships for students pursuing coursework, research or internships abroad. The International Study Abroad Scholarship is available for USD law students only.

If you are a USD law student who is interested in submitting an application to be considered for a USD International Study Abroad Scholarship, please complete the web form below. Please attach your resumé and a brief essay (1-2 pages) describing the program you have selected, how this experience will enhance your legal education and why you require financial assistance.

Applications are reviewed once each program's application deadline has been reached.

Students may submit this funding request for any international activity likely to enhance the student's legal education.

These may include internships with:

  • governmental, private or non-profit employers in foreign countries,
  • USD-sponsored summer and semester study abroad programs,
  • research projects in foreign countries under the direction of a USD or
  • foreign faculty member or other supervised study abroad experience

All scholarship applications are reviewed by a committee and approval is based on financial need, academic merit and potential and the value of the international experience to the student.
